Description
The accolades on the wall of this restaurant suggest that it's one of the best, most innovative Chinese spots in the city. But look closer—the articles are all from 1993. Since then, it doesn't appear that the restaurant has changed much, neither in the dining room nor on the menu. But even if it no longer feels new, it is at least still solid. Because some Chinese basics—pudgy pork-stuffed dumplings; salty, crispy soft-shell crabs with stir-fried chiles; sauteed bean curd with ground pork—don't have an expiration date.

Good, dependable Chinese, plus some Taiwanese dishes you won't find elsewhere. Incredible value for the money—you'd think the prices hadn't changed since 1993, either. But, there's sitll no liquor license, and after 15 years, they obviously don't intend to get one, so do your drinking elsewhere.
